Public Transport and Road Connections

Stoke Heath benefits from a well-connected transport network, making it accessible for both residents and visitors. The area is serviced by several bus routes that link it to Coventry city centre and surrounding areas, providing convenient options for daily commuting. These services operate with regular schedules, ensuring that public transport is a viable choice for those opting to leave their cars at home.

Road connections are also a significant aspect of Stoke Heath’s accessibility. The A444 trunk road passes nearby, facilitating quick access to major routes, including the M6 motorway. This connectivity enhances the area's appeal for businesses and commuters alike, leading to smoother travel experiences and an efficient flow of traffic within the region.
